Bluetooth AVRCP controller returns BT_ERROR_NOT_SUPPORTED

Hello everyone,

I'm new at programming with tizen, I tried yesterday a small watchface with a bluetooth avrcp controller. Bluetooth is working and I can scan my devices, but when ich found my device and want to use the audio controller, it returns with the error "BT_ERROR_NOT_SUPPORTED". I don't understand why this is?

I started with a new tizen project in tizen studio and selected "watch", cause i want a new watch face. I initialize BT via bt_initialize() -> working. then I call  bt_avrcp_control_initialize -> not working.

Can I not use AVRCP at a watch face? Or do i have to do something before call avrcp_control_initilize?
